A "Red" Level Magnetic Storm Engulfed Earth on Monday

IKI RAN predicts a 40% probability of geomagnetic disturbances

A "red" level magnetic storm (K-index 5) is observed on Earth. This phenomenon may affect the well-being of some people, causing headaches and a general deterioration of health. This is reported by the Meteoagent portal, which aggregates satellite data.

On Monday, the storm will reach its peak at 5 points. However, its level will weaken to "yellow" tomorrow, and then drop to normal values.

Magnetic storms can cause discomfort in people sensitive to changes in the magnetic field, so it is recommended to avoid overexertion and pay attention to your condition today.

The forecast of magnetic storms for March 2025 will be updated as data is received from satellites and laboratories around the world, notes the Meteoagent portal.

In turn, IKI RAN predicts that in the next 24 hours the probability of a calm magnetosphere is 29%, the probability of geomagnetic disturbances is 40%, and the probability of magnetic storms is 31%. The Earth's magnetosphere is now calm (Kp = 2.67), and it is expected to remain calm in the near future (Kp = 3.67).
